Cardi B just received a pretty big co-sign. On Saturday morning, the Bronx rapper went to social media with a screenshot of an O, the Oprah Magazine Instagram post that was captioned: “Listening to that new Cardi B album.” The image showed the legendary entrepreneur with her eyes closed and a satisfied smirk across her face.

Cardi, of course, was in disbelief.

“I CAAAANNNNTTTTTT BELIIIEEEEEVEEEEESS IT!!!!!!!!!!--------OMMMMMGGGGGGGGGGGG,” she captioned the screenshot.

Shortly after Cardi shared the news with her fans, congratulations poured in:

The rapper’s long-awaited debut album, Invasion of Privacy, officially hit streaming services Friday. The project included appearances from Chance the Rapper, SZA, 21 Savage, and Migos, with production by DJ Mustard, Murda Beatz, Boi-1da, and more.

“I am so grateful for everybody that decided to be on my album because as an artist, I know how busy artists are,” she said during a recent interview with Beats 1's Ebro Darden. “For them to take the time and do it exactly right. Everything came out how I wanted it to come out. Perfect hooks, perfect verses. It was just like, ‘Jesus loves me, I must have done something right in my life.’”

Cardi will also make her Saturday Night Live debut alongside host Chadwick Boseman the night after Invasion of Privacy's release.
